Web11 apr. 2024 · As well as reaching speeds of up to 6mph in the water, polar bears can swim for long distances and steadily for many hours to get from one piece of ice to another. Their large paws are specially adapted for swimming, which they’ll use to paddle through the water while holding their hind legs flat like a rudder. © Steve Morello / WWF 4.

In some regions the sea ice is now … 勉強 ルーティン おすすめWebHow far can a polar bear swim? The longest recorded nonstop swim a polar bear has ever made is 426 miles over nine days straight. Watch out Michael Phelps - that's equivalent to the distance between Washington, D.C., and Boston. During the swim, the female bear lost 22 percent of her body weight. au 迷惑メールフォルダWeb22 jul. 2011 · Longest Polar Bear Swim Recorded—426 Miles Straight Study predicts more long-distance swims due to shrinking sea ice.
